Fill in the blanks with appropriate prepositions
1. It’s very efficient …… code and assets.
A. With
B. Out
C. In
D. Off
2. They are efficient…….doing this.
A. Through
B. Out
C. In
D. At
3. This makes things efficient …… you.
A. Through
B. Out
C. For
D. Off
4. It is too soon to say whether that normal course of events will be diverted …… the effects.
A. Through
B. Out
C. By
D. Off
